Heck, beyond getting Luck back, revamping the offensive line will be the biggest positive to the 2018 season if Ballard does it right! Add in a new offensive system which, hopefully, can start to replicate the offensive success that the Cheats have been able to employ for years (without the cheating, of course)? Dude, I get that we have talent holes all over the roster; Grigson screwed the team big time. But a 2016 Andrew Luck (injury and all) would have taken the 3-13 2017 Colts and turned them, by himself as the only change, into at least a 9 or 10 win team. Colts losses in 2017 were by: 1, 3, 3, 3, 4, 6, 7, 12, 14, 20, 27, 28, 35 7 losses by 1 TD or less. Are you telling me that Andrew Luck is not worth 7 points more per game than Jacoby Brissett? Both in 15 games: 469 attempts / 276 completions / 58.8% / 3,098 yards / 13 TD / 07 INT / 52 sacks / 81.7 QB Rating / 260 rush yards / 4 rush TD / 2017 Brissett 545 attempts / 346 completions / 63.5% / 4,240 yards / 31 TD / 13 INT / 41 sacks / 96.4 QB Rating / 341 rush yards / 2 rush TD / 2016 Luck You, and no one else outside of a small, tight circle around Luck, has any idea to his injury concerns. To make emphatic statements that he is done or will not recover is just stupid. Walk Worthy, |
